The Message ~ Roxann Spicer

  • Roxann gave her testimony that God was calling her to quit her employment. As you can understand if you put yourself in her shoes, fear got the best of her and she didn't obey until months later. After putting in her notice, thus living on one income, she lived on God's promise to never leave her,  to provide for her. And he did!! God spoke to many people to bless this family!
  • God wanted her to wait, to be patient, to let Him take care of her. And when she 'turned the corner', her previous employer called for her to come back.
  • Salvation: simply yielding to what God says for my life. Consciously making each decision.
  • God has a plan and purpose for your life!

  • We get restless between planting seeds and harvest. BUT Christ's time is not our time.
There is a due season; Wait.
We can count on three things:
  • A. God WILL cause a harvest to come from our seeds (words and works)
  • B. Our harvest will have the same nature as our seen sown. You can't cover your ground with doubts or fear; cover it with Faith.
  • C. God is never early and never late
What do you do during the growing time?
  • Refuse to be discouraged (Gal 6:9)
  • Determine to keep our faith alive and active (Psalm 91). Read these verses with Declaration! Now re-read the first 2 verses...
  • Give and keep on giving; love and keep on loving. Spirit-directed words, action, giving, serving, and loving are all good seeds. God has promised to multiply those good seeds back to you. 
  • Know this... Your harvest is guaranteed! Continue in an attitude of expectancy.
  • PROCLAIM God's promises; DECLARE God's goodness, awaits fullness, trustworthiness; RECITE scripture that address you situation; CONFESS your trust in Him to Him, and others.
  • 'Patience'... Hold the ground gained.
  • Like the childhood game 'King of the Hill'... You fight to get on top of the hill, and you continue to fight to stay on the hill.
